Alonso Martínez
Alonso Martínez is an emerging talent in Costa Rican football, currently playing for Liga Deportiva Alajuelense. His impressive performances in the youth leagues have earned him a spot on the national under-17 team, where he is seen as a key contributor to their recent successes.
